Mrs. Lois Elvenia DeBerry

Mrs. Lois Elvenia DeBerry, age 84, of Trion, GA, passed away Wednesday, June 11, 2014 at her residence.

Mrs. DeBerry was born February 14, 1930, in Chavies, AL, daughter of the late Clifford Shankles and Ada Ann Reeves Shankles.  She was a homemaker and a member of the Emanuel Baptist Church.  In addition to her parents, Mrs. DeBerry was preceded in death by her sisters, Maxine Lumpkin, Doris Payne, Faye Miller, and Mary Wade; brothers, George Wesley and Kelly Shankles; and a son-in-law, Rick Grosjean.

Mrs. DeBerry is survived by her husband, Rev. Sanford DeBerry; son and daughter-in-law, Larry and Roni DeBerry; daughters and son-in-law, Sandi and Dale McCollum, Tracie Grosjean; Renita Chambers and Tony Carnes; a sister, Mae Morgan; 5 grandchildren; and 3 great-grandchildren.

Funeral services for Mrs. DeBerry will be held at 2:00 P.M. Saturday, June 14, 2014, from the Mason Funeral Home Chapel with Rev. Kevin Norton and Rev. Steve Spears officiating.  Interment will follow in the Mill Creek Cemetery.  Pallbearers will be James DeBerry, Dale McCollum, Allen Chambers, Ryan DeBerry, Don Morgan, and Steve Cohen.

Mrs. DeBerry will be in state at Mason Funeral Home and the family will receive friends from 6:00 until 8:00 P.M. Friday.

Mason Funeral Home is in charge of the arrangements.
